Raju Sharma, who works as support staff at the nodal office of the District Cooperative Bank, shared a video on social media on Saturday that quickly went viral. In the video, Raju claimed that an officer posted at the Cooperative Bank in Guna has been harassing him. He said that the officer threatened him over the phone at night and later had him transferred to Shadora. Raju said this situation has caused him a lot of mental stress and worry.

Raju shared not just one, but two videos to explain his condition. He said that his monthly salary is only ₹8,900. Even with such a small income, he was transferred to Shadora. He explained that traveling to Shadora daily would cost him around ₹50, which would put an extra financial burden on him.

He said that with these expenses, it would become difficult for him to manage his household. In the video, Raju mentioned the name of Praveen Raghuvanshi, who works at the CCB (Central Cooperative Bank) headquarters in Guna, and alleged that he was the one behind the transfer and harassment.

On the other hand, when Praveen Raghuvanshi was asked about these allegations, he clearly denied them. He said that he neither called Raju Sharma on the phone nor signed any order related to his transfer to Shadhaura. He added that he has no involvement in the matter and believes Raju might be under some kind of misunderstanding.

This entire issue is now being discussed widely, especially on social media, and has raised questions about how support staff are being treated within the cooperative banking system.
